linux

Linux Oracle数据库的性能瓶颈在哪

小樊
39
2025-06-09 05:41:01
栏目: 云计算

Linux Oracle数据库的性能瓶颈可能出现在多个方面,以下是一些常见的原因:

  1. 硬件配置不足

    • CPU性能低下。
    • 内存不足。
    • 磁盘I/O速度慢。
  2. SQL语句优化不当

    • 全表扫描。
    • 使用子查询。
    • 缺乏适当的索引。
  3. 索引缺失

    • 缺少用于查询的索引,导致查询速度变慢。
  4. 内存配置不合理

    • SGA(System Global Area)和PGA(Program Global Area)配置不当。
  5. I/O瓶颈

    • 磁盘I/O速度慢,影响数据的读取和写入效率。
  6. 数据库设计不合理

    • 表结构不合理。
    • 冗余数据设计。
    • 复杂的关系。
  7. 并发控制不当

    • 锁机制。
    • 事务隔离级别。
  8. 网络延迟

    • 网络带宽不足。
    • 网络延迟高。
  9. 日志管理不当

    • 日志文件过大。
    • 日志写入频率过高。
  10. 系统参数配置不当

    • 数据库初始化参数配置不当。
    • 优化器参数配置不当。
    • 内存参数配置不当。
  11. 定期维护不足

    • 数据碎片整理不足。
    • 索引重建不足。
    • 统计信息更新不足。

解决这些瓶颈需要综合考虑硬件、软件、查询优化、并发控制等多个方面,通过监控工具分析性能指标,找出具体的瓶颈并进行相应的优化措施。

0
看了该问题的人还看了